Connecting laptop to desktop

Can I connect my macBook to my iMac, sort of like an external hard drive, so I can pull large files off it? If so, what cable/port should I use?
iMac G5   Mac OS X (10.4.5)  
iMac G5   Mac OS X (10.4.5)  

Hook both machines up with a FireWire cable and start one computer with the T key held down. That computer's hard disk should then appear on the other machine's desktop, and you can then copy files to or from it.

    In addition to the unlimited $29.99 data plan, you would also need a $29.99 tethering plan, so it would cost you $60 a month - and the connection would not be as good as your DSL.  And we use our DSL to connect to a router and have several laptops and desktops using our DSL, which would not work with a tethered connection.  My advice - skip the tethering and keep the DSL.

  • Tranferring video between laptop and desktop

    Is it possible to -via a USB/Firewire- to transfer some FCE work from my laptop directly to my Imac or do I need to pop it onto a DV tape and load it into the Imac?
    Thanks.

    You can transfer files from one Mac to another via Firewire using what's called Target Disk Mode.
    To do this, power on your iMac while holding down the letter T key. Keep holding down the T key until you see the standard yellow firewire logo appear on the iMac's screen (that's all that will be on the screen, just the firewire logo.) Then connect your laptop to your iMac with a Firewire cable and start up your laptop. Your iMac will show up on your laptop's desktop just as if it were another disk drive. From there you can use the Finder (on your laptop) to copy files & folders to your iMac.
    When you're done, shut down your laptop. Then turn off your iMac by holding down the power button until it shuts off. Then turn off the power to both Macs. Then unplug the firewire cable.
    Voila ... done.
    ps. This is not a hack ... this is a standard Apple procedure. And, obtw, it cannot be done via USB
